celebrating the purple one

 Anna and I had a bit of a disagreement today about great music artists. I said Prince was the greatest frontman that ever lived. "Yes, frontman!" she said, "...but Taylor Swift is the best frontwoman! I suggested that honor would probably go to Beyonce but we agreed to disagree. 

After visiting the memorial at First Avenue we headed out to Paisley Park to hang some signs. 
Anna had written a note thanking Prince for the cool music and Sophia designed a thank you sign from our cousin Priya who is a huge Prince fan but lives out in California.
The amount of people today was staggering but we were treated to some pizza thanks to the Paisley Park staff and we lucked out on our timing as the rain subsided during our visit, only to resume the moment we returned to our car.

waxing nostalgic of nye's

 Given the culinary revival that has taken place in town over the last fifteen years it's hard getting too sentimental about Nye's Polonaise. With its track record as a hard knock place (given you could never get any service and when you did it wasn't good)...and when the food did show up it was never anything to write home about; I still have a special place in my heart for this place. Our first date took place here and because of that we have our wonderful family and we feel blessed that we could bring our kids here one time before it met the wrecking ball. As far as nostalgia goes; we hope the girls look back on their youth and remember the fabulous Twins ballpark, Patisserie 46 and whatever else is actually fantastic about living in this wonderful city right now because the time we are living in now, truly is a time to remember.   



 ...and yes, we never did get any service at Nye's today so after we took our pictures we headed down the road to Santana Foods, across the street from where mom and pop had their first kiss and got some true comfort food (steak sandwiches and gyros).
